WebTriclopyr as an active ingredient is a systemic foliar herbicide, which means it is applied to the foliage of a plant and then travels down to the roots. Triclopyr is used primary to … WebFeb 16, 2012 · Triclopyr 3 herbicide is used for the control of woody plants, vines, annual and perennial broadleaf weeds in forests and non-crop areas. WebTriclopyr is available in either ester or amine formulations. Triclopyr ester is more effective on brooms, since this formulation is more easily absorbed into the foliage and stems.
